#157548 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#157548 is composed of 8.2% red, 45.9%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 82.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 38.5% yellow and 54.1% black. It has a hue angle of 151.9 degrees, a saturation of 69.6% and a lightness of 27.1%. #157548 color hex could be obtained by blending #2aea90 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006633.

Shades and Tints of #157548

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000100 is the darkest color, while #effcf6 is the lightest one.
